This dataset provides Census 2021 estimates that classify usual residents in England and Wales by their proficiency in English. The estimates are as at Census Day, 21 March 2021.

Summary

How well people whose main language is not English (English or Welsh in Wales) speak English.

Proficiency in English language: Total: All usual residents aged 3 years and over 23,350
Main language is English (English or Welsh in Wales) 22,761
Main language is not English (English or Welsh in Wales) 589
Main language is not English (English or Welsh in Wales): Can speak English very well 263
Main language is not English (English or Welsh in Wales): Can speak English well 221
Main language is not English (English or Welsh in Wales): Cannot speak English well 86
Main language is not English (English or Welsh in Wales): Cannot speak English 19

These values are calculated by adding up the values for census output areas contained within Brownhills. They may, therefore, be slightly inaccurate due to administrative boundaries not precisely aligning with census boundaries.
